Output 223d5c2520f7bf9bc43ba5aac3a32f91cf0148c6a41c3ae6e91982185bb11622:24

value
15354000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0e14f3e169cd7cc23834a1af835780924a1c03 OP_EQUAL
address
3HU3h9uA2JSVzGGfcgnbz4J1e6pyLsWa1j
transaction
223d5c2520f7bf9bc43ba5aac3a32f91cf0148c6a41c3ae6e91982185bb11622
confirmations
229719
spent
true